The National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A) offers a detailed meaning of medication addiction, mentioning, "dependency is defined as a chronic, relapsing mind illness that is identified by compulsive medication seeking as well as usage, regardless of hazardous consequences." Dependency is acknowledged as a brain condition due to the fact that medicines essentially create adjustments to the brain. This could be a tough concept to comprehend, however it's true. Exactly how does it work?

Drugs which are habit forming operate in the brain by producing satisfaction (recognized in scientific research as reward). They cause the brain's incentive system, and interrupt the regular messaging circulation. Dopamine, a natural chemical in the brain, can be located in the areas of the brain which are in charge of feeling, sensations of enjoyment, cognition, motivation, as well as activity. When individuals take drugs, this incentive system becomes overstimulated, usually from an excess accumulation of dopamine. This generates the rush feeling individuals tend to crave when abusing compounds. Gradually, and also with prolonged misuse of drugs, an individual's mind re-shapes itself to seek this new method of creating reward. Basically, the mind makes an individual yearn for that rush feeling time and again.

Individuals who could have created dependency will certainly profit most from comprehensive therapy. Getting enjoyed ones the assistance they need might be hard, though. Commonly, addicted people are not all set to confess they have a material usage problem, and also this could provide a problem for talking to them regarding it. When challenging an individual regarding dependency, make sure to do it in a risk-free, open setting, as well as to make use of soft tones. Enable lots of time, as well as try to prevent public locations so the person does not feel struck or degraded. Most importantly, allow the person understand you care, and also tension the importance of therapy in their recuperation from addiction.

Medication Addiction Can Be Treated

When attempting to recognize medicine dependency signs in those around you, behavior modifications might be the biggest idea. As an example, individuals who are freshly impacted by medicine addiction may begin falling behind in school or job performance, or could no more have rate of interest in tasks they used to like. They could likewise not pay much attention to their appearance, or may disregard their health and wellness. Individuals with establishing addictions could likewise come to be deceptive in an effort to hide their dependencies, especially if they are not prepared to encounter their disorder yet.
